Outbound from S. Station it is a breeze. Take the Franklin line. Get off the train at Dedham Corp., cross the street on same side where you got off the train, walk straight through the parking lot across the street, and you are there. (Albeit on the backside.)

It's also a short Uber ride to or from the University Ave Station at 128 on the Providence Line.
